cotton grass — n. any of a genus (Eriophorum) of grasslike plants of the sedge family, with flower heads resembling tufts of cotton, common in northern bogs … English World dictionary

cotton rose — noun 1. Chinese shrub or small tree having white or pink flowers becoming deep red at night; widely cultivated; naturalized in southeastern United States • Syn: ↑Confederate rose, ↑Confederate rose mallow, ↑Hibiscus mutabilis • Hypernyms:… … Useful english dictionary
